Oh come, oh come, Emmanuel



Oh come, oh come, Emmanuel,
And ransom captive Israel,
That mourns in lonely exile here
Until the Son of God appear.

Rejoice! Rejoice! Emmanuel
Shall come to you, O Israel.


Oh come, oh come, great Lord of might,
Who to your tribes on Sinai's height
In ancient times once gave the law
In cloud, and majesty, and awe.

Rejoice! Rejoice! Emmanuel
Shall come to you, O Israel.


Oh come, strong branch of Jesse, free
Your own from Satan's tyranny;
From depths of hell your people save
And give them victory over the grave.

Rejoice! Rejoice! Emmanuel
Shall come to you, O Israel.


Oh come, blest Day-spring come and cheer
Our spirits by your advent here;
Disperse the gloomy clouds of night,
And death's dark shadows put to flight.

Rejoice! Rejoice! Emmanuel
Shall come to you, O Israel.


Oh come, O Key of David, come,
And open wide our heavenly home;
Make safe the way that leads on high,
And close the path to misery.

Rejoice! Rejoice! Emmanuel
Shall come to you, O Israel.
